About
British Airways (BA) is the United Kingdom’s flag carrier airline with headquarters in London near its main hub at London Heathrow Airport (LHR). BA is the second largest UK-based airline in terms of fleet size and number of passengers carried. Known as a full-service global airline, British Airways offers year-round low fares to destinations worldwide and flies to and from centrally-located airports. Its extensive global route network includes more than 170 destinations in nearly 80 countries throughout Europe, North America, South America, Asia, Africa and Australia. syn p British Airways (BA) is the flag carrier airline of the United Kingdom with its headquarters in London near its main hub at London Heathrow Airport (LHR). Known as a full-service global airline, BA offers low fares year-round to destinations around the globe and flies to and from centrally-located airports. Its extensive global route network includes more than 170 destinations in nearly 80 countries throughout Europe, North America, South America, Asia, Africa and Australia. BA is also the second largest airline based in the UK in terms of its fleet size and number of passengers carried.

Lufthansa

About
Lufthansa is Germany’s largest airline and one of the leading carriers in Europe, connecting travelers to destinations worldwide from its main hubs in Frankfurt and Munich. Its modern fleet offers a wide choice of travel experiences, from Economy Class with affordable fares and onboard entertainment to Premium Economy, Business Class, and First Class with extra comfort, fine dining, and exclusive lounge access.

KLM

About
KLM Royal Dutch Airlines is the flag carrier of the Netherlands and the world’s oldest airline still operating under its original name. Based in Amsterdam Schiphol Airport, KLM connects travelers to destinations across Europe, Asia, Africa, and the Americas. Its modern fleet offers comfort for every type of journey—from affordable Economy fares with in-flight entertainment and WiFi to Premium Comfort and Business Class with extra space, dining, and lounge access. With a reputation for excellent service and global connectivity, KLM is a trusted choice for international travel.

TAP Portugal

About
TAP Air Portugal is the national flag carrier and the largest airline in Portugal, with its main hub at Humberto Delgado Airport in Lisbon. As a member of the Star Alliance, TAP operates an average of 2,500 flights per week to more than 90 destinations in over 30 countries. Many of its aircraft feature USB outlets for charging devices, while most long-haul flights include complimentary onboard entertainment with movies, TV shows, music, and games. For travelers looking for affordable options, TAP also offers low-cost fares on select routes, making it easy to find cheap flights with the airline.

Iberia Express

About
Iberia Express is a Spanish low-cost airline, a subsidiary of Iberia and part of the International Airlines Group (IAG). Established in 2011 and commencing operations in March 2012, it focuses on short and medium-haul routes from its hub at Adolfo Suárez Madrid–Barajas Airport. The airline primarily serves high-frequency domestic routes and leisure destinations within Europe, also providing feeder flights to Iberia's long-haul network. Iberia Express has been recognized for its punctuality, being named the most on-time airline in Europe for 2023.

For international flights we recommend to arrive 2.5 to 3 hours before departure. Please check the website of your departure airport if in doubt. Some airports may offer booking time slots for security checks or offer additional information on when to get there based on time of day.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e. G. 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s).
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
